Welcome to Hooked on Walking holidays and our walking holidays in Italy. This particular hiking vacation in Italy is in the Tuscan region just north of Siena. This walking tour has been graded as a level 2 self guided tour. You will experience hilltop fortified towns, Etruscan ruins, medieval boroughs, vines and olive gardens. You will explore the wonderful countryside of this part of Tuscany starting from the superb Siena, the medieval Pompeii. From  the medieval walled citadel of Monteriggioni to the  towered town of San Gimignano and its gentle vineyards of Vernaccia to the the etruscan and medieval town of Volterra.

Day 1 Arrival to Siena, explore the old town (3km)
Our representative will meet you in Siena  and will introduce you to your walking tour. If you arirve in enough time have an exploratory walk in the main roads and narrow alleys. Siena is one the best preserved medieval cities in Europe, a true masterpiece of art and architecture with its gothic duomo, the museums and famous buildings and the shell shape  square “Il Campo” the scene of the holy (because dedicated to the Virgin), and mad horse race “The Palio”Hiking Holiday in Tuscany

Day 2 Siena transfer to S. Colomba walk to Strove 7.5 miles 12 km
A walk today on paths and gravel roads across rolling hills. Some small sections are steep. You will walk through some beautiful woods of the Montagnola Senese - a home of wildboars.

Day 3 Strove- Monteriggioni – Strove 8.75 miles 14 km
Today you will see some wonderful views of tuscan towns and countryside, the evergreen oak wood of the Montagnola Senese and  the stunning medieval citadel of Monteriggioni. Strove is a small medieval tuscan village. Monteriggioni is a medieval hilltop village with its very well preserved crown of city walls and watch towers.

Day 4 Strove – Colle di Val d’Elsa 6.25 miles 10km
Today you continue your walk across this wonderful Tuscan countryside . Of course stop for lunch or take a picnic but enjoy this shorter relaxing day.
Your destination Colle Val d’Elsa is a medieval market town. Today Colle is famous for its crystals (a medieval tradition). There is also an interesting Etruscan Museum.

Day 5 Colle di Val d’Elsa – S.Gimignano 8.75 miles 14km
Views of tuscan towns and countryside today as your path will enter the medieval  Pilgrim way to Rome “ Via Francigena” . This is still today a popular pilgrimage route as the “ Camino di Santiago” San Gimignano one of our favourite towns lies on the site of an Etruscan settlement dated 3rd century B.C. It developed during the Middle Ages thanks to the pilgrimage route, the Via Francigena,  which runs through the town. Of the original 72 medieval towers only 14 remain to witness the great power and richness of the past.Walking Holiday in Tuscany

Day 6 S.Gimignano – Sensano with transfer to Volterra, 8.75 miles 14km
Today you can continue to admire beautiful views of the countryside and the Vernaccia vineyards.Then you  will pass near the ruins of a medieval castle and will cross a beautiful ever-green oak wood.  Volterra: is surrounded by two defensive walls one Etruscan the other medieval, it is one of the most important centres of Tuscany for its monuments that testify to 3000 years of civilization and its traditional alabaster craftmanship.

Day 7 Departure
End of tour after breakfast. From Volterra bus connections are available to Cecina on the coast. From Cecina train station you can reach Pisa,  Florence and Rome. Difficulty: A level 2 walk. Trips with easy day walks which are interspersed with more strenuous sections. Four to five hours walking per day ( excluding breaks ) in hilly to mountainous areas using well kept but sometimes stoney paths.

Accommodation: A mixture of  very nice 3 stars hotels and guest houses,  all comfortably located within the historical centre, most of them are family run.
